[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[freewnn:00582] Re: patches after FreeWnn-1.1.1-a017



小野寛生です

From: Hiroaki Abe <h-abe@pc.highway.ne.jp>
Date: Mon, 21 May 2001 01:15:01 +0900

> BeOS R5でもmakeしてみました。
> #取り敢えず、make CPP=`gcc -print-prog-name=cpp`
> 以下の変更が必要でした。動作確認はこれから。

すみません。BeOS R5 用の patch いれてませんでした。
汎用でどう変えていくかはともかく、まずは阿部さんの patch をあてておく
べきでしたね。

> +#if (defined(__unix__) || defined(unix) || defined(BEOS)) && !defined(USG)
>  #include <sys/param.h>
>  #endif

しまったなあ。MAXPATHLEN が必要なところで、無条件に <sys/param.h> を
include してしまったんですが、wnn_os.h あたりでこういうことをやって、
wnn_os.h の方を取り込むべきでしょうか。
% config.h で HAVE_MAXPATHLEN とか HAVE_SYS_PARAM_H とか?
%% ない場合はどうすんのか…。


http://www.freewnn.org/ FreeWnn Project